## Runbook: Garagepulse occupancy feed

Garagepulse polls stall sensors at the Harbrook deck and publishes occupancy counts every 30s. If counts freeze, restart the poller; if they oscillate, check sensor debounce. Reviewer note: the retry logic was rewritten last sprint — confirm backoff caps at 5 minutes and that stale readings older than 2 minutes are dropped, not averaged. Feed consumers assume monotonic timestamps. The poller runs with the configuration below.

config for yajep-tafof:
[rusath]
team = julmir
access_code = ac_fe37fd
host = rusath.novactech.test
port = 8000
owner = pelmir.weneth
peer = oliwyn.olvarqdyn.internal

Migration step 4 — descriptor leak hunt on Fennelworth

Before moving traffic off the old Quillbase pool, confirm the leaked-file-descriptor fix is active. We traced the leak to unclosed sockets in the retry path; the patched build caps open handles and logs a warning at 80% of the limit. Run the soak test for two hours and watch the gauge plateau. The watcher reads these configuration values at startup.

settings of bawif-fawif:
ralix:
  log_level: warn
  metrics_host: metrics.ralix.tolvaqsys.internal
  pool_size: 32

### Summary

Adds the Nightloom scheduler for nightly backfill jobs on the Cinderpath warehouse. Jobs are sharded by partition date and throttled to avoid starving the morning report pipeline. Retries use capped exponential backoff, and concurrency is bounded per source table. The defaults shipping with this PR are as follows.

tuning table, fahop-kajof:
QUOTAS = {
    "ulaath": 5,
    "wenwyn": 2,
    "quenwyn": 10,
    "quenix": 1,
}

To the incoming director: effective next quarter, the marketing budget for the Branwick product line is reduced by 18%. The cut reflects the board's decision to prioritize the Ostrel platform rebuild and does not signal reduced confidence in Branwick. Sponsorships and the Harlowe campaign are paused; digital retention spend is protected. Your team leads have been notified and transition plans are drafted. Please review the allocation sheet before your first planning session. A confidential note on related business plans follows below.

board note of kadup-kageg: Ralaelek Systems is in early talks to buy Kasdorax Logistics for about $187.4 million. The Tamvan launch date is December 22, and nothing goes to the press before then. Legal wants the Gilaelix Works term sheet countersigned before November 3.